218: Moving Country - It can be so complicated this concept of belonging but I do feel very at home here with Lily Asch

This special episode is very close to home (pun intended) as we explore the mental health impacts both positive and negative that can come with moving as your hosts both go through this experience. We are also joined by repeat guest and friend of the pod Lily Asch who shares her experience moving to Budapest during the pandemic. Best Health Podcast 4 years running at The People’s Choice Podcast Awards 🏆 Mental was created by Bobby Temps to break down mental health stigma and discrimination. Joined by special guests, the podcast is a safe space to hear honest and insightful mental health interviews in the hope listeners will feel more empowered to continue the conversation with others. Every other Thursday we delve into a factor in mental health and how to better manage it. You’ll also better understand different conditions from first-hand experience, with inspiring guests and surprising statistics. Start listening from any episode or topic that interests you.
